Hailing from Six Nations of the Grand River, Mohawk artist Logan Staats is one of the most electrifying voices in contemporary roots and rock music. Fresh from his triumphant performance at the Los Angeles Forum in front of 18,000 fans for Life is a Carnival: A Musical Celebration of Robbie Robertson, Staats continues to use his voice across the world.
He earned a JUNO Award nomination for his album A Light in the Attic, the TD SOCAN Indigenous Songwriter Award, a Native American Music Award, charted #7 on the iTunes Rock Chart and reached #1 on the Indigenous Music Countdown with “Medicine Wheel.” He delivered a commanding performance at the prestigious Governor General’s Performing Arts Awards and was selected to perform in London at AmericanaFest UK.
He first gained national attention through CTV’s The Launch, where his debut single “The Lucky Ones” soared to #1 in Canada.
A land defender, cultural tastemaker, and sought-after collaborator, Staats brings his raw, electrifying performances to audiences across Canada, and around the world. He has worked with Allison Russell, Terra Lightfoot, and Serena Ryder, and has supported icons like Eric Clapton and Steve Earle.
